[mythtv-users] transcode error 'no video information found'

Daniel Carter dantheperson at gmail.com
Sun Aug 31 16:31:30 UTC 2008


OK, to answer my own issue,

I saw went into Utilities / Setup -> Setup -> TV Settings -> Recording
profiles -> Transcoders -> Autodetect from MPEG2

opened the settings and saved them, and now it works.  Looks like a bug in
myth that you have to open and save a profile before it can be used ( maybe
something to do with upgrading from older releases compared to a clean
install )

The questions remains though, how can i selet different transcoding profiles
when transcoding?

Also, i thought there was a setting to have it keep the original file?  I
can't find it now, but it would be very useful to have until i am happy with
the transcode results.


2008/8/31 Daniel Carter <dantheperson at gmail.com>

> Hello all,
>
> I'm trying to get transcode to work from the broadcast MPEG2 (UK freeview
> DVB-T) to DIVX to save some space.
>
> Trying a manual job, if i trigger it either from the front-end or mythweb,
> it errors out with a message "No video information found!"
>
> Looking at the code, this seems to indicate i haven't set the transcoder
> profile to use.  I have setup a my own transcoder profile under:
>
> Utilities / Setup -> Setup -> Tv Settings -> Recording Profiles ->
> Transcoders
>
> However, when i transcode from the front-end ( Media Library -> Watch
> recordings -> <my recording> -> job options -> being transcoding )
>
> the options it gives me are Default / auto detect/ high quality / medium
> quality / low quality. The new transcoding profile i have setup is not
> there.
>
> If i use mythweb, it doens't prompt me for a profile at all.
>
> Where do i need to tell it to which transcode profile to use???
>
>
> TIA,
> dan.
>
> 00563         if (vidsetting == "MPEG-4")
> 00564         {
> 00565             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etOption <http://cuymedia.org/mythtv-0.21/classNuppelVideoRecorder.html#ddaf0e8a8ea326823ce1da88e8e8e56c>("videocodec", "mpeg4");
> 00566
> 00567             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4bitrate");
> 00568             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"scalebitrate");
> 00569             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4maxquality");
> 00570             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4minquality");
> 00571             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4qualdiff");
> 00572             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4optionvhq");
> 00573             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"mpeg4option4mv");
> 00574             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etupAVCodecVideo <http://cuymedia.org/mythtv-0.21/classNuppelVideoRecorder.html#0f3313ce72efa524d6e6d44c3d52994c>();
> 00575         }
> 00576         else if (vidsetting == "RTjpeg")
> 00577         {
> 00578             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etOption <http://cuymedia.org/mythtv-0.21/classNuppelVideoRecorder.html#ddaf0e8a8ea326823ce1da88e8e8e56c>("videocodec", "rtjpeg");
> 00579             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"rtjpegquality");
> 00580             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"rtjpegchromafilter");
> 00581             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etIntOption <http://cuymedia.org/mythtv-0.21/classRecorderBase.html#ea7962a2d7c0812dabc594a9eeaafc99>(&profile <http://cuymedia.org/mythtv-0.21/classTranscode.html#9c370550e28c5034d741ced95df4431e>, "rtjpeglumafilter");
> 00582             nvr <http://cuymedia.org/mythtv-0.21/classTranscode.html#28fa9dcc8640e99bbf75e8d2820a94d4>->SetupRTjpeg <http://cuymedia.org/mythtv-0.21/classNuppelVideoRecorder.html#00d6ac22bd42be93d9d162de97ac85ae>();
> 00583         }
> 00584         else if (vidsetting == "")
> 00585         {
> 00586             VERBOSE <http://cuymedia.org/mythtv-0.21/namespaceofdb.html#afe7a317e0f140b219faaa8536db264d>(VB_IMPORTANT, "No video information found!");
> 00587             VERBOSE <http://cuymedia.org/mythtv-0.21/namespaceofdb.html#afe7a317e0f140b219faaa8536db264d>(VB_IMPORTANT, "Please ensure that recording profiles "
> 00588                                   "for the transcoder are set");
> 00589             return REENCODE_ERROR;
> 00590         }
>
>
>
>
>
> 2008-08-31 16:57:16.898 JobQueue: Transcode Starting for Family Guy "Ready,
> Willing and Disabled": Auto
> detect (710.7 MB)
> 2008-08-31 16:57:19.626 Using runtime prefix = /usr, libdir = /usr/lib
> 2008-08-31 16:57:19.801 Empty LocalHostName.
> 2008-08-31 16:57:19.831 Using localhost value of rebirth
> 2008-08-31 16:57:20.434 New DB connection, total: 1
> 2008-08-31 16:57:22.869 Connected to database 'mythconverg' at host:
> localhost
> 2008-08-31 16:57:22.890 Closing DB connection named 'DBManager0'
> 2008-08-31 16:57:22.898 Connected to database 'mythconverg' at host:
> localhost
> 2008-08-31 16:57:22.959 Enabled verbose msgs: important
> 2008-08-31 16:57:23.014 New DB connection, total: 2
> 2008-08-31 16:57:23.488 Connected to database 'mythconverg' at host:
> localhost
> 2008-08-31 16:57:24.131 Transcoding from
> /var/lib/mythtv/recordings/1007_20080827222500.mpg to
> /var/lib/mythtv/recordings/1007_20080827222500.mpg.tmp
> 2008-08-31 16:57:26.300 Connecting to backend server: 10.1.1.254:6543 (try
> 1 of 5)
> 2008-08-31 16:57:27.164 Using protocol version 40
> 2008-08-31 16:57:27.509 MainServer::HandleAnnounce Monitor
> 2008-08-31 16:57:27.770 adding: rebirth as a client (events: 0)
> 2008-08-31 16:57:27.909 MainServer::HandleAnnounce Monitor
> 2008-08-31 16:57:28.143 adding: rebirth as a client (events: 1)
> 2008-08-31 16:57:34.562 AFD: Opened codec 0x81edd20, id(MPEG2VIDEO)
> type(Video)
> 2008-08-31 16:57:34.758 AFD: codec MP3 has 2 channels
> 2008-08-31 16:57:34.839 AFD: Opened codec 0x81ee360, id(MP3) type(Audio)
> 2008-08-31 16:57:34.923 AFD: Opened codec 0x81ee9a0, id(DVB_SUBTITLE)
> type(Subtitle)
> 2008-08-31 16:57:34.936 AFD: codec MP3 has 0 channels
> 2008-08-31 16:57:35.010 AFD: Opened codec 0x81eefe0, id(MP3) type(Audio)
> 2008-08-31 16:57:40.207 Transcode: Looking for autodetect profile:
> Autodetect from 576i
> 2008-08-31 16:57:40.526 New DB connection, total: 3
> 2008-08-31 16:57:40.823 Connected to database 'mythconverg' at host:
> localhost
> 2008-08-31 16:57:42.269 Transcode: Using autodetect profile: MPEG2
> 2008-08-31 16:57:42.443 No video information found!
> 2008-08-31 16:57:42.598 Please ensure that recording profiles for the
> transcoder are set
> 2008-08-31 16:57:42.756 Transcoding
> /var/lib/mythtv/recordings/1007_20080827222500.mpg failed
> 2008-08-31 16:57:43.043 Deleting
> /var/lib/mythtv/recordings/1007_20080827222500.mpg.tmp
> 2008-08-31 16:57:46.917 MainServer::HandleAnnounce Playback
> 2008-08-31 16:57:46.922 adding: rebirth as a client (events: 0)
> 2008-08-31 16:57:46.926 MainServer::HandleAnnounce FileTransfer
> 2008-08-31 16:57:46.932 adding: rebirth as a remote file transfer
> 2008-08-31 16:57:47.062 MythSocket(841ef48:-1): writeStringList: Error,
> socket went unconnected.
> 2008-08-31 16:57:47.144 JobQueue: Transcode Errored: Family Guy "Ready,
> Willing and Disabled": Autodetect (exit status 255, job status was
> "Errored")
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://mythtv.org/pipermail/mythtv-users/attachments/20080831/7ed11527/attachment-0001.htm 


More information about the mythtv-users mailing list